Which Race of Men Gets the Most Success on Dating Apps? Full Breakdown w/ Sources (OkCupid, 25M+ Interactions)



Overview

This thread compiles data from large scale studies on racial preferences in online dating, focused on men's success rates (reply rates, attractiveness ratings, and match data). Primary sources include OkCupid's OkTrends dataset (25M+ interactions, 2009 to 2014), Quartz/Are You Interested (2.4M+ interactions), and several peer reviewed academic studies.

Key metric: Average reply rate = % of women who reply when messaged. Higher = more success.



Rankings (Most to Least Successful)

RankGroupTierAvg Reply RateBarKey Notes
#1White Men■ TOP~31.1%██████████Most replied to group across virtually all women's racial categories. Highest attractiveness ratings on OkCupid. Particularly favored by Asian, Hispanic, Indian, and white women.
#2Middle Eastern / Arab Men■ TOP~27.9%█████████Consistently rank 2nd in reply rate data. Both straight and gay men's data shows women respond best to Middle Eastern profiles after white men. Sharp features perceived as broadly attractive across groups.
#3Native American Men■ MID-HIGH~29.8%█████████High reply rates in OkCupid data, though sample sizes are smaller than other groups. Often outperforms other minority groups in raw reply metrics within the US context.
#4Hispanic / Latino Men■ MID-HIGH~25.2%████████Broadly mid tier. Latina women show a stronger preference for white men which limits intra group success on apps. White and Black women respond reasonably well.
#5East Asian Men■ MID-LOW~25.3%████████Average reply rate but a consistent attractiveness rating penalty applied by women of all groups including Asian women. Receive fewer unsolicited messages. Frequently cited alongside Black men as the most disadvantaged groups on dating apps.
#6South Asian / Indian Men■ MID-LOW~23.7%███████Notably low reply rates from Indian women. Best reply rate comes from Black women (~34%). Out marriage rates rising in real life by 2023 but app performance stays below average.
#7Black Men■ LOW~22.6%███████Lowest attractiveness ratings and reply rates among men in OkCupid data. 82% of non Black men show some bias against Black women which creates a structural imbalance in the dating pool. Pattern is consistent across OkCupid, DateHookup, and Are You Interested datasets.



Additional Findings

  • White men get replies from 1 in ~3.4 women, the best ratio of any group.
  • Black men get replies from 1 in ~4.4 women, the lowest ratio.
  • 82% of non Black men on OkCupid show some bias against Black women.
  • Asian and Hispanic women reply to non white men at rates of ~21.9% and ~22.9% respectively.
  • Black women reply the most generously overall yet receive the fewest replies back from men.
  • Middle Eastern men have a notably high outgoing reply rate (~49.7%), they are not very selective when messaging.
  • South Asian men are least desired by Indian women specifically, not by all women equally.
  • Biases stayed consistent from 2009 to 2014 and were cross validated across multiple platforms.
  • In speed dating studies at Columbia University, 47% of matches were interracial, much higher than real world marriage rates, suggesting apps capture stronger racial filtering than in person dating does.



Important Caveats

  • Data is US centric, results may differ in Europe, MENA, Asia, etc.
  • Reply rate does not equal relationship or hookup success. In person social skills, looks, status, and context matter more in the real world.
  • Rankings reflect aggregate statistical patterns, not individual experience.
  • Preferences are shaped by media representation, social structures, and lived experience, not purely innate.
  • OkCupid data is from 2009 to 2014, more recent large scale public datasets are harder to access.
